membership-win membership-win

Bamboo Lip Balm - 122953

1100 in stock
last updated at 16-04-2025 02:52

| Main Main
Bamboo Lip Balm 122953 | Natural Natural
Bamboo Lip Balm 122953 | Feature Feature

Bamboo Lip Balm - 122953



Vendor :Trends